CLEVELAND, OH (WOIO) –

19 Action News has learned police were called to the property of convicted serial killer Anthony Sowell overnight.

Someone cut a gaping hole in a large fence surrounding the property.

The intruder somehow set off an alarm at a business next door.

They were not able to get inside the Sowell home, but police have started guarding the property around the clock again.

Police had backed off on the hours of surveillance once Sowell’s trial was over.

In August, Sowell was sent to death row for killing 11 women.
